Transaction 2c73a85c52be40db6c8d1899a0dc3b3f069e1b68d15bf695d337f9f588e75273

3 Input
1 Outputs
  • 2c73a85c52be40db6c8d1899a0dc3b3f069e1b68d15bf695d337f9f588e75273:0
  • value  6807116
    address  3CR9vGQmiu9urdUC3fWYR4urQDLjYzhLDg